Re: SilverPlatter default change suggestion




Sounds good to me.  The only drawback I can see would be that it might change 
the default for downloading from short labels to long labels--something that 
might mess up people popping their citations into endnote.  Endnote needs the 
short labels to process the records.  But the user can change the option back to 
short labels when downloading if they know to do so.

But this said, i imagine the number of people using stuff like endnote and 
reference manager is small compared to the number that use the databases and 
would benefit from more understandable field names.
